Output d344b9485a273f0906411b19acc4333280075c62545671f94d5b51449059d1b9:6

value
42689771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d9170f3ca694b5e9a14f34de39aabccdee OP_EQUAL
address
3BMEXcAqgWziwytGsf7MYRkapczhZEGSuU
transaction
d344b9485a273f0906411b19acc4333280075c62545671f94d5b51449059d1b9
spent
true